How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Rock River?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Rock River Studio Apartments | $1,341 | $700 | $2,600 |
Rock River 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,338 | $630 | $3,100 |
Rock River 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,743 | $734 | $4,200 |
Rock River 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,422 | $987 | $2,031 |
Rock River 4 Bedroom Apartments | $912 | $565 | $1,504 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Rock River
How much are Studio apartments in Rock River?
There are currently 3 Studio Apartments in Rock River with rent ranges from $700 to $2,600 with an average price of $1,341.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Rock River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Rock River ranges from $630 to $3,100 with an average monthly rent of $1,338.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Rock River c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Rock River range from $734 to $4,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,743.
How expensive are Rock River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 14 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Rock River on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$987 to $2,031 - averaging $1,422 for the location.
